NH Liquor Commission opens new Liquor and Wine Outlet Store in Milford to replace old store

By Staff | Sep 7, 2013

A New Hampshire Liquor & Wine Outlet Store has opened in Milford. Located in Market Basket Plaza on Route 101, the New Hampshire Liquor & Wine Outlet replaces the store on Route 101A (Elm Street) in Granite Town Plaza.

The new has nearly 3,000 feet more of space, allowing the New Hampshire Liquor Commission to offer an expanded selection of wine and spirits. The store is also spacious enough to accommodate special events, such as tastings.

The store’s open concept incorporates energy-efficient LED lighting, spacious aisles and curved, free-standing shelving.

“Because of its proximity to other southern New Hampshire communities, the Milford store serves customers from a large geographic area,” said New Hampshire Liquor Commissioner Joseph W. Mollica. “This new store on Route 101 gives customers access to many more products than the previous location, conveniently arranged in a more shoppable setting to improve the consumer experience.”

The New Hampshire Liquor Commission has been responsible for the renovation and relocation of several New Hampshire Liquor & Wine Outlets, including Gilford, Plaistow, Portsmouth, North Hampton, Hampstead, Manchester, Merrimack, Nashua, Lincoln, Lebanon, Concord, Peterborough, West Chesterfield and inside the Manchester-Boston Regional Airport.

Hours for the new Milford store are 10 a.m.-6 p.m. Monday-Wednesday, 10 a.m.-8 p.m. Thursday-Saturday, and 10 a.m.-5 p.m. Sunday.

An official grand opening will be announced at a later date.
